#a429b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a429b5 is composed of 64.3% red, 16.1%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.4% cyan, 77.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 292.7 degrees, a saturation of 63.1% and a lightness of 43.5%. #a429b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#49006b.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#a429b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a429b5 has RGB values of R:164, G:41,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 10758581.

Shades and Tints of #a429b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050105 is the darkest color, while #fcf4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a429b5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706d71 is the less saturated color, while #be07d7 is the most saturated one.
